Description

The Cynaeus angustus, known as the larger black flour beetle, is a significant pest belonging to the order Coleoptera and the family Tenebrionidae. It has gained attention as a serious threat to stored grain commodities and processed food products, often becoming established in mills, grain elevators, and warehouses across various regions.

This beetle species targets a broad range of stored products, including wheat, corn, barley, oats, and various flour-based goods. It is particularly known for attacking products that are not kept under optimal sanitary conditions, effectively infiltrating bulk storage systems and causing considerable damage to stored batches of cereals.

The biological cycle of this pest involves complete metamorphosis, consisting of the egg, larval, pupal, and adult stages. The beetles are highly adaptive to varying environmental conditions, allowing them to complete their life cycle rapidly in warm and humid environments. Larvae are typically found deep within the grain mass or inside the structures of storage facilities.

The damage caused by Cynaeus angustus is primarily through consumption of grain embryos and endosperm, leading to weight loss and reduced nutritional quality. Furthermore, their presence promotes the accumulation of moisture within the grain, which creates ideal conditions for microbial decay and mould growth, rendering the commodity unfit for market or consumption.

Effective management requires a multi-faceted approach to pest control. Sanitation and proactive inspection are the foundations of reducing the risk of infestation. Recommended strategies include:

  • Rigorous cleaning of storage infrastructure to remove food residue.
  • Maintaining optimal grain moisture levels to discourage pest activity.
  • Utilization of chemical fumigation for severe infestations in sealed environments.
  • Regular pheromone or light trapping to monitor population dynamics.
